Checkmarx CISO Study Reveals High Impact of AppSec Maturity on Business Prospects for 96% of CISOs

In a recent report released by Checkmarx, it has been found that application security (AppSec) is playing an increasingly crucial role in closing new business and shaping organizational processes. The report, titled “Global CISO Survey: The Growing Impact of AppSec on Business,” is based on the survey responses of 200 CISOs and other senior security executives worldwide in March of this year.

One of the key findings of the study is that 84% of CISOs reported being called into sales engagements to help close sales of their company’s products and services. This highlights the connection between AppSec and business growth. Prospects are increasingly considering the level of application security when making purchase decisions, with 96% of CISOs confirming this. This indicates that organizations need to prioritize application security to remain competitive in the market.

Furthermore, the study revealed that 77% of CISOs estimate that their companies are running at least half of their businesses on applications for which internal teams must ensure security. As enterprises undergo digital transformation initiatives and rely more on complex applications for their digital business, CISOs are in need of better risk management strategies and consolidation of security alerts and dashboards. This consolidation allows them to prioritize their developers’ remediation tasks effectively.

The report also highlighted that the banking and financial services industry is more frequently confronted with the request for AppSec considerations in purchase decisions compared to other industries. Around 50% of CISOs in this sector reported that AppSec was strongly considered when making purchasing decisions. In contrast, only 24% of CISOs in the industrial and manufacturing industry reported the same. However, there is a growing trend across all industries, especially industrial and manufacturing, for prospects to inquire about the level of application security before making a purchase.

The survey, conducted online by an independent survey company, included a mix of CISOs, CSOs, CIOs, Deputy CISOs, Deputy CSOs, and Deputy CIOs from companies across various industries and regions. The respondents were approached by the research panel and invited via email to participate. Measures were taken to prevent order bias in answering non-numerical questions.
